This specific kind of crossword clue is a testament to the elegant simplicity and deceptive depth of crossword construction. It’s not asking for a synonym, nor is it a complex anagram. Instead, it taps into your lexical intuition, challenging you to find a single, common word that seamlessly precedes two seemingly disparate words, forming a valid compound noun or a widely recognized phrase with each. For anyone tackling a daily crossword clue, mastering this format is a key step towards becoming a more efficient solver.

Let’s dissect the mechanics of approaching such a crossword clue. When faced with ‘Word before ‘drop’ or ‘drum”, your brain immediately begins a fascinating process of association. For ‘drop’, you might think of things that fall, liquid measures, confections, or even a sudden decline. For ‘drum’, images might conjure musical instruments, large cylindrical containers, or even parts of the body. The real challenge of this crossword clue lies in identifying the
intersection
– that singular word that makes perfect sense in both contexts. It requires you to consider the multiple meanings and common usages of ‘drop’ and ‘drum’ and then filter for a shared predecessor. This is where your expansive vocabulary and grasp of idiomatic expressions come into play for this particular crossword clue.
